The Pride of Jerusalem’s Women
16 And Yahweh said: “Because[a] the daughters of Zion are haughty,
and they walk with outstretched neck,
and they give flirting glances with their eyes,
mincing along as they go,[b]
and with their feet they rattle their bangles,[c]
17 the Lord will make the heads[d] of the daughters of Zion scabby,
and Yahweh will lay their foreheads bare.”
18 In that day the Lord will take away the finery of the anklets
and the headbands and the crescent necklaces,
Footnotes
- Isaiah 3:16 There are two Hebrew words for “because” here
- Isaiah 3:16 Literally “they go walking and mincing along”
- Isaiah 3:16 Literally “they tinkle with their feet”
- Isaiah 3:17 Hebrew “head”
